Stay warm this season with new supplies in our Health Resources vending machines!
You can now find winter essentials like emergency blankets, warm socks, hats, and gloves at our kiosks to help keep you safe and warm.
Kiosk Locations:
• Douglas County Health Department
1111 S 41st Street, Omaha, NE 68105
• Washington Branch Library
2868 Ames Avenue, Omaha, NE 68111
• Siena Francis House
1117 N 17th Street, Omaha, NE 68102
• American Dream
7402 F Street, Omaha, NE 68127
• Nebraska Urban Indian Health Coalition
2226 N Street, Omaha, NE 68107

The University of Pittsburgh School of Medicine is offering a full scholarship for undergraduate students who are American Indian, Alaska Native, and Native Hawaiian communities who are interested in scientific careers and aging research. This cohort will be at the University of Minnesota from August 2 - August 7, 2026.
Room & Board, and Travel will be covered in the scholarship!
